Planning Guardianship & Durable Power of Attorney in Georgia

Navigating this state's court framework regarding guardianship and durable power of attorney can be complex . Conservatorship usually involves a court appointing someone to manage an adult who doesn't have the capacity to manage their personal matters . In contrast , a power of attorney allows an person to appoint someone to make decisions for them, if they are still capable . It’s essential to grasp the distinctions between these options , as together with the particular requirements dictating them under state statutes .
